#644e2e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#644e2e is composed of 39.2% red, 30.6% green and 18%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 22% magenta, 54% yellow and 60.8% black. It has a hue angle of 35.6 degrees, a saturation of 37% and a lightness of 28.6%. #644e2e color hex could be obtained by blending #c89c5c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666633.

#644e2e color description : Very dark desaturated orange.

#644e2e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#644e2e has RGB values of R:100, G:78, B:46 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.22, Y:0.54,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 6573614.

Shades and Tints of #644e2e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060503 is the darkest color, while #fcfaf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#644e2e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4e4a44 is the less saturated color, while #915601 is the most saturated one.
